<p><span style="font-size: 12pt;">Eric Mac Lain is a former offensive lineman at Clemson University who now works as a college football analyst with the ACC Network. During his time at Clemson, he was a part of two conference championships and made a national championship appearance in his senior year of 2015. At the time of his graduation, he obtained the most wins (46) by a single player in Clemson history, while earning Strength and Conditioning All-America honors.</span></p> <p><span style="font-size: 12pt;">As a student, Mac Lain was an All-ACC Academic football selection and graduated with a Bachelor’s in health science (2015) and a Master’s in athletic leadership and administration (2017). In 2019, he joined the new ACC Network as a studio analyst. </span></p> <p><span style="font-size: 12pt;">Today on the podcast, we welcome back Eric Mac Lain to the show to talk about how becoming a dad has changed his life and why it is important for him to love others the way Jesus has loved us. </span></p> <hr /> <p><em>Looking for faith/sports gift ideas?
